Unlike Western platforms that rely heavily on programmatic ad revenue, Korean streaming platforms rely primarily on direct viewer donations. On AfreecaTV, these are known as "Star Balloons" (byulpoongsun). Viewers purchase these tokens and gift them to BJs in exchange for shoutouts, song requests, or specific reactions—such as a dance ("danza"). Why Do Strings Like "5721004" Trend Globally?
